Output d86de3886ee88fa03766bc4a86716183f87c64e3fbb1da3cd3f79c5d1cb303bb:1

value
647088
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c9bca17d4854ba13e46b13a7a7415629f20bb0271dc4b14bb6abc3cf1d068367
address
bc1pex72zl2g2jap8ertzwn6ws2k98eqhvp8rhztzjak40pu78gxsdnsxhxxdm
transaction
d86de3886ee88fa03766bc4a86716183f87c64e3fbb1da3cd3f79c5d1cb303bb
confirmations
42398
spent
true